Medical Conditions Requiring Wheat Avoidance

For some individuals, consuming wheat can trigger severe, even life-threatening, health consequences. These cases are not a matter of personal preference but a medical necessity. The primary conditions necessitating the strict avoidance of wheat are Celiac Disease, Wheat Allergy, and the rare Wheat-Dependent Exercise-Induced Anaphylaxis (WDEIA).

Celiac Disease: An Autoimmune Reaction

Celiac disease is a serious autoimmune disorder affecting approximately 1% of the U.S. population. It is triggered by the ingestion of gluten, a protein found in wheat, barley, and rye. In genetically predisposed individuals, eating gluten causes the immune system to attack and damage the villi, the finger-like projections lining the small intestine. This damage impairs nutrient absorption and can lead to a range of symptoms and long-term health problems. Strict, lifelong adherence to a gluten-free diet is the only effective treatment.

Symptoms of Celiac Disease can be varied and may include:

  • Severe diarrhea or constipation
  • Abdominal pain and bloating
  • Severe weight loss or failure to gain weight
  • Fatigue and depression
  • Skin rashes (Dermatitis Herpetiformis)
  • Joint pain
  • Anemia

Wheat Allergy: An Immune System Overreaction

A wheat allergy occurs when the body's immune system overreacts to one of the proteins found in wheat, producing IgE antibodies. This is distinct from celiac disease because it is a classic allergic reaction, not an autoimmune response to gluten itself. Reactions can range from mild to severe, appearing within minutes to hours after exposure.

Common symptoms of a wheat allergy include:

  • Hives or skin rash
  • Swelling, itching, or irritation of the mouth or throat
  • Nausea, cramps, vomiting, or diarrhea
  • Nasal congestion
  • Headaches
  • Trouble breathing or wheezing
  • Anaphylaxis (in severe cases)

Non-Celiac Wheat Sensitivity (NCWS)

NCWS, sometimes called non-celiac gluten sensitivity, is a condition in which individuals experience symptoms after consuming wheat or gluten, but have tested negative for both celiac disease and wheat allergy. While the exact trigger is still debated (potential culprits include gluten, amylase-trypsin inhibitors (ATIs), or FODMAPs), removing wheat from the diet often provides symptom relief.

Symptoms associated with NCWS can resemble celiac disease or irritable bowel syndrome (IBS) and may include:

  • Abdominal pain and bloating
  • Fatigue and 'brain fog'
  • Diarrhea or constipation
  • Headaches
  • Anxiety and depression
  • Joint and muscle pain

Distinguishing Wheat-Related Conditions

To help clarify the differences, the following table compares the key features of these three conditions:

Feature Celiac Disease Wheat Allergy Non-Celiac Wheat Sensitivity
Immune Response Autoimmune response to gluten Allergic (IgE-mediated) reaction to wheat proteins Innate immune activation, potential gut barrier issues
Intestinal Damage Yes, damage to the small intestine villi No direct intestinal damage Mild or no intestinal damage reported in some cases
Symptoms Gastrointestinal and systemic, long-term complications if untreated Varies, can be immediate (hives, breathing) or delayed (digestive) Resembles IBS, fatigue, brain fog; improves on wheat-free diet
Diagnosis Blood tests and intestinal biopsy Skin prick tests and IgE blood tests Diagnosis of exclusion; confirmed by double-blind placebo challenge

Potential Risks of Avoiding Wheat Without Medical Necessity

For individuals without a diagnosed medical condition, eliminating wheat unnecessarily can carry risks. Whole grains, including whole wheat, provide essential nutrients that support overall health.

Risks of unwarranted wheat avoidance include:

  • Nutrient Gaps: Many wheat-based foods are enriched with fiber, B vitamins, and iron. Gluten-free alternatives often lack these nutrients.
  • Reduced Fiber Intake: Eliminating whole grains can decrease fiber intake, which is crucial for digestive health and can lead to constipation.
  • Higher Costs: Gluten-free products are frequently more expensive than their wheat-based counterparts.
  • Misdiagnosis: Some feel better temporarily simply by cutting back on processed foods, not necessarily by avoiding wheat itself. True medical conditions could be overlooked without proper diagnosis.

Hidden Sources of Wheat

Navigating a wheat-free diet requires careful label reading, as wheat can hide in unexpected places. Here are some less obvious sources of wheat:

  • Processed meats: Sausage, hot dogs
  • Sauces and gravies: Many are thickened with wheat flour
  • Ice cream cones
  • Soy sauce
  • Modified food starch (unless specified as from corn or another source)
  • Hydrolyzed vegetable protein (HVP)
  • Natural flavorings

Conclusion: Seek Professional Guidance

Ultimately, the decision to avoid wheat should be made in consultation with a healthcare professional. While the wheat-free trend is popular, it is medically necessary only for specific conditions like celiac disease, wheat allergy, and non-celiac wheat sensitivity. For those without a diagnosis, wheat, especially whole wheat, can be a valuable part of a balanced diet, providing important nutrients and fiber. If you suspect a problem with wheat, consulting a doctor or dietitian is the best path to an accurate diagnosis and a sustainable, healthy dietary plan.
